Peanut Butter Rice Flour Treats with Carob

Tails wagging from Texas...let's bake some treats!


Today we're making some special occasion treats. One of Katara's good dog friends is having a birthday and we thought we'd show up to the puppy play date with something special. Most dogs love peanut butter and rice flour is easier on the tummies than wheat flour. We threw in flax seeds for added benefits (and cuteness) and some are even getting dipped in carob. Let's get started!

Getting started...

You Will Need:
- 2 cups brown rice flour
- 1/2 cup peanut butter
- 1/2 cup milk
   *We used cow's milk, but you can use goat's milk if your dog has issues with dairy
- 1 large egg
- 1 TBSP flax seeds (optional)
- 1/2 cup carob chips

How They're Made:
1.) Preheat oven to 350F
2.) Combine the flour, peanut butter, egg and flax seed. Mix to begin forming your dough.
3.) Add milk gradually until your dough is perfect. You want it a little sticky but not crumbly or soggy.
4.) Roll out the dough and use your favorite cookie cutter. To make it easier, use saran wrap to keep the dough from sticking to the rolling pin.
5.) Put cookies on a greased oven sheet and bake for about 25 minutes.
6.) (Optional) Melt carob chips in the microwave in 10 second intervals until melted. Dip your cookies in the carob or use the carob to make designs.
7.) Let cookies cool on the counter or in the fridge if you dipped them in carob. Store in the fridge and enjoy!
